Closet Skeletons
Open that old closet door, Dig out the memories once more. Sort the old bones, sweep the ashes, start a new pile of trashes. Remember the good times, forget the tears, once again bare all your fears. Feel your heart sink a-bit, cherish a past trinket. put them neatly back in place, toss the ones that aren't so great. leave the past behind the door, view what's in sight once more. By d.d.
